The Hugh Wooding Law School is located in Trinidad and Tobago and trains students from various Carib Holders of a Legal Education Certificate will be regarded by all governments in the West Indies as having satisfied institutional and educational requirements for practise, but locallegislation may add further requirements such as nationality, which must be satisfied before the right to practise is granted in a particular territory. Sovereignty speaks to 'the totality of exclusive rights, powers and privileges which international law recognizes a state as entitled to exercise in relation to an ascertainable area of territory, including the superjacent air space, and the persons, assets and resources therein, subject to compliance with obligation correlative to the enjoyment of those powers, rights, and privileges 1 .'
